Ingredients:

  • 1/2 pound white American cheese
  • 1/4 cup milk (you may need a little more if you prefer a thinner consistency)
  • 1 tablespoon butter
  • 1 4 oz can of green chilies
  • 1/4 teaspoon cumin
  • 1/4 teaspoon garlic salt
  • 0.125 tsp cayenne pepper (this is just a pinch, adjust to your spice preference)
  • Preparation Steps

    Here’s how we’re going to bring this incredible white cheese dip to life. The process is straightforward, focusing on gentle heat and constant stirring to ensure a smooth, lump-free texture.

    1. Getting Started: The Base
    Begin extract by preparing your ingredients. It’s always a good idea to have everything measured and ready to go before you start cooking. Cube the white American cheese into small, manageable pieces. This will help it melt more evenly and quickly. If you can’t find white American cheese, you can use a good quality mild white cheddar or Monterey Jack, but the American cheese provides that signature melty texture that’s hard to beat. In a medium saucepan, add the tablespoon of butter and place it over low to medium-low heat. We want the butter to melt gently, not brown. Once the butter has melted, add the cubed white American cheese to the saucepan.

    2. Melting the Cheese: Patience is Key
    Now, the crucial part: melting the cheese. Keep the heat on low to medium-low. The goal is to melt the cheese slowly and evenly, preventing it from scorching or becoming oily. Stir the cheese almost constantly with a wooden spoon or a heat-resistant spatula. You’ll notice it starting to soften and clump together. Continue to stir, coaxing it into a smooth consistency. This can take a few minutes, so resist the urge to crank up the heat. If the cheese seems to be melting too quickly or is starting to look a bit greasy, remove the pan from the heat for a moment and continue stirring. The residual heat will do the work.

    3. Adding the Liquid and Flavor
    Once the cheese has mostly melted and is starting to look creamy, it’s time to add the milk. Pour in the 1/4 cup of milk. Stir it in gradually, incorporating it into the melted cheese. If you find the dip is too thick for your liking at this stage, don’t hesitate to add another tablespoon or two of milk, a little at a time, until you reach your desired consistency. Remember, the dip will thicken slightly as it cools. Now, let’s add the flavor! Drain the 4 oz can of green chilies and add them to the cheese mixture. Next, sprinkle in the 1/4 teaspoon of cumin, the 1/4 teaspoon of garlic salt, and the tiny pinch of cayenne pepper. Stir everything together thoroughly, ensuring the spices are evenly distributed throughout the creamy cheese.

    4. Simmering and Achieving Perfection
    Continue to cook the mixture over low heat, stirring frequently, for another 2 to 5 minutes. This simmering time allows the flavors to meld together beautifully and ensures the dip is heated through. The green chilies will soften further and distribute their mild, smoky flavor. The cumin adds a warm, earthy undertone, while the garlic salt provides a savory punch. The cayenne pepper, even in such a small amount, adds a subtle warmth that balances the richness of the cheese without making it overtly spicy. Keep stirring throughout this phase to maintain a smooth, velvety texture. If the dip starts to look too thick, add another splash of milk. Conversely, if it’s thinner than you like, continue to simmer gently for a minute or two longer, stirring constantly, to allow some of the liquid to evaporate.

    5. Serving Your Masterpiece
    Once your white cheese dip has reached your desired consistency and all the flavors have married, it’s ready to be served! Carefully pour the hot dip into your favorite serving bowl. It’s best enjoyed immediately while it’s warm and gooey. For an extra touch, you can garnish the top with a sprinkle of chopped fresh cilantro or a few more of those delicious green chilies. Serve with plenty of your favorite tortilla chips, pita bread, or even cut-up vegetables for dipping. This dip is also fantastic as a topping for loaded baked potatoes, quesadillas, or as a base for an appetizer platter.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ator. To reheat, gently warm it in a saucepan over low heat, stirring occasionally, or microwave in short bursts, stirring in between, until heated through. You may need to add a splash of milk to loosen it up when reheating. Enjoy every glorious, cheesy bite!

    Frequently Asked Questions about Mexican White Cheese Dip:

    Q: How do I prevent my white cheese dip from becoming grainy?

    A: The key to a smooth, creamy dip is to use good quality cheese and to melt it slowly over low heat, stirring constantly. Avoid overheating the cheese, as this can cause the proteins to separate and result in a grainy texture. Some recipes also recommend adding a little cornstarch or flour to the milk before adding the cheese to help stabilize it.

    Q: Can I make this white cheese dip ahead of time?

    A: Absolutely! You can prepare the dip up to a day in advance. Let it cool completely, then store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ator. When you’re ready to serve, gently reheat it on the stovetop over low heat, stirring frequently, or in the microwave in short intervals, stirring after each one, until it’s smooth and heated through. You may need to add a splash of milk or cream to thin it out slightly if it has become too thick.
